Let’s get started
By clicking ‘Next’, I agree to the Terms of Service
and Privacy Policy
Jobs / Job page
Senior / Staff Site Reliability Engineer - Remote /Europe image - Rise Careers
Job details

Senior / Staff Site Reliability Engineer - Remote /Europe

About Us

At xLabs, we provide core infrastructure and contribute to open-source technologies that empower the builders of the Internet of Value. We focus on engineering tools and delivering robust infrastructure to enable the seamless development of decentralized applications. As core contributors to Wormhole, we’re helping build the backbone of the Internet of Value and making contributions to all major blockchains.

About the Role

  • You are capable of working efficiently in distributed teams, with a strong focus on clear and frequent communication.

  • You think critically about the problems presented to the team and can propose multiple solutions, ideally documented in written form.

  • You are proactive, taking initiative while keeping the team’s success in mind.

  • You are comfortable communicating in English, both verbally and in writing.

  • You have experience with Infrastructure-as-Code and GitOps.

  • You have experience with workload orchestration solutions, such as (but not limited to) HashiCorp Nomad or Kubernetes.

  • You can reason about software design and distributed systems.

  • You are proficient in at least one programming language.

  • You have experience running blockchains, particularly validators and remote signers/multisig. (nice to have)

What We Do

We manage compute infrastructure and the applications that depend on it. Most of these applications, like blockchains, are not designed or implemented by us. Thus, we do a lot of reading—documentation, code, Slack channels, and Discord servers—to develop an informed understanding of each app's architecture, best operating practices, and debugging techniques when things go wrong. Documenting what we learn, including what went wrong and how to prevent future issues, is also a big part of our work.

Benefits

  • A fully remote team (from anywhere!)

  • An amazing culture

  • A flexible work schedule

  • A generous vacation policy celebrating well-deserved time off

Xlabs Glassdoor Company Review
5.0 Glassdoor star iconGlassdoor star iconGlassdoor star iconGlassdoor star iconGlassdoor star icon
Xlabs DE&I Review
5.0 Glassdoor star iconGlassdoor star iconGlassdoor star iconGlassdoor star iconGlassdoor star icon
CEO of Xlabs
Xlabs CEO photo
Unknown name
Approve of CEO
What You Should Know About Senior / Staff Site Reliability Engineer - Remote /Europe, Xlabs

At xLabs, we're on the cutting edge of technology, and we're looking for a talented Senior / Staff Site Reliability Engineer to join our fully remote team! If you're passionate about infrastructure and contributing to open-source technologies, this is the perfect opportunity for you. As a core contributor to the Wormhole project, you will play a vital role in building the backbone of the Internet of Value. You'll thrive in our collaborative environment, where clear communication and problem-solving are paramount. Your primary responsibilities will include managing our compute infrastructure and the myriad applications that rely on it, much of which are blockchains designed by others. This position requires you to think critically and document multiple solutions to the problems you encounter, ensuring that your knowledge is shared across the team. Whether you're orchestrating workloads with Kubernetes or HashiCorp Nomad, or diving deep into the intricacies of distributed systems, your expertise will help shape the future of decentralized applications. Proficiency in at least one programming language is essential, and familiarity with running blockchains is highly regarded. In return, you’ll enjoy a generous vacation policy, a flexible work schedule, and an amazing culture that emphasizes well-deserved downtime. If you’re looking to make a real impact while working from anywhere in Europe, we’d love to hear from you at xLabs!

Frequently Asked Questions (FAQs) for Senior / Staff Site Reliability Engineer - Remote /Europe Role at Xlabs
What are the main responsibilities of a Senior / Staff Site Reliability Engineer at xLabs?

As a Senior / Staff Site Reliability Engineer at xLabs, you will manage compute infrastructure and ensure the smooth operation of decentralized applications. Your role involves problem-solving, documenting solutions, and communicating effectively within a distributed team. You'll also work with Infrastructure-as-Code, GitOps, and workload orchestration tools like Kubernetes or HashiCorp Nomad, focusing on enhancing system reliability.

Join Rise to see the full answer
What qualifications are necessary for the Senior / Staff Site Reliability Engineer position at xLabs?

To qualify for the Senior / Staff Site Reliability Engineer position at xLabs, candidates should possess a strong understanding of distributed systems and software design. Proficiency in at least one programming language is required, along with experience in running blockchains. Familiarity with Infrastructure-as-Code and orchestration tools is essential for success in this role.

Join Rise to see the full answer
What is the work culture like for a Senior / Staff Site Reliability Engineer at xLabs?

At xLabs, the work culture is collaborative and supportive, emphasizing clear communication and teamwork. As a fully remote team, we value flexibility and a healthy work-life balance. Our generous vacation policy allows team members to take well-deserved breaks, ensuring that everyone remains productive and engaged.

Join Rise to see the full answer
Is prior experience with blockchain technology required for the Senior / Staff Site Reliability Engineer at xLabs?

While prior experience with blockchain technology is not mandatory for the Senior / Staff Site Reliability Engineer position at xLabs, it is considered a nice-to-have. Familiarity with running validators, remote signers, or multisig will certainly enhance your application and may provide you with a deeper understanding of our core systems.

Join Rise to see the full answer
How does xLabs support the professional growth of Senior / Staff Site Reliability Engineers?

At xLabs, we believe in fostering professional growth for our team members, including Senior / Staff Site Reliability Engineers. We provide opportunities for continuous learning through knowledge sharing, documentation, and access to valuable resources. Additionally, our collaborative work environment encourages sharing insights and skills with colleagues, supporting everyone’s growth journey.

Join Rise to see the full answer
Common Interview Questions for Senior / Staff Site Reliability Engineer - Remote /Europe
Can you describe a situation where you improved system reliability?

When answering this question, focus on a specific example from your previous experience. Highlight the tools you used, your problem-solving approach, and the outcome of your efforts. Quantifying the improvements, such as reduced downtime or increased performance, can showcase your impact effectively.

Join Rise to see the full answer
What tools have you used for workload orchestration, and why did you choose them?

Mention specific tools like Kubernetes or HashiCorp Nomad, and discuss the reasons behind your choice. Consider factors such as scalability, ease of use, community support, and specific use cases. Providing real-world examples of how you've utilized these tools can demonstrate your depth of knowledge.

Join Rise to see the full answer
How do you document solutions to problems in a remote environment?

Explain your approach to documentation, emphasizing tools and methods that work best in remote settings. Mention platforms like Confluence, GitHub wiki, or even collaborative documents that allow collective input. Share your philosophy on sharing knowledge and ensuring everyone on the team can benefit from past experiences.

Join Rise to see the full answer
What are the key considerations when implementing Infrastructure-as-Code?

Discuss critical factors such as version control, testing, and consistency across environments. Highlight any tools you’ve used, like Terraform or CloudFormation, and how you ensure that your Infrastructure-as-Code implementations are reliable, maintainable, and scalable.

Join Rise to see the full answer
How would you approach a sudden outage in a production environment?

Describe your step-by-step process for handling an outage. Start with assessing the situation, identifying the affected services, and communicating with the team. Explain how you would troubleshoot the issue, implement a fix, and later conduct a post-mortem to assess what went wrong and how to prevent similar issues.

Join Rise to see the full answer
Can you explain your experience with version control and its importance in site reliability engineering?

Emphasize your familiarity with version control systems like Git. Discuss how they enable collaboration, track changes, and facilitate rollbacks in case of issues. Mention specific instances where version control was critical in maintaining system reliability and supporting team workflows.

Join Rise to see the full answer
What programming languages are you proficient in, and how have you applied them in site reliability engineering?

List the programming languages you are skilled in, and provide examples of how you’ve utilized them to automate tasks, manage infrastructure, or analyze logs. Highlight any specific projects where your programming skills had a significant impact on system performance or reliability.

Join Rise to see the full answer
Describe your experience with cloud platforms in the context of infrastructure management.

Mention specific cloud platforms you’ve worked with, such as AWS, Azure, or Google Cloud. Discuss how you leveraged their services for deploying, managing, and scaling applications. Provide examples of challenges you faced in these environments and how you overcame them to enhance system reliability.

Join Rise to see the full answer
What strategies do you use to ensure effective communication within a distributed team?

Share the tools and practices you prefer for communication, such as Slack or video conferencing platforms. Emphasize the importance of regular check-ins, clear documentation, and creating a culture of openness where team members feel comfortable sharing their thoughts and concerns.

Join Rise to see the full answer
How do you stay current with advancements in site reliability engineering and technology?

Discuss your commitment to continuous learning through online resources, forums, conferences, or workshops. Mention any communities you’re part of that focus on site reliability engineering, and share how you apply the latest trends and best practices in your work.

Join Rise to see the full answer
Similar Jobs
Photo of the Rise User
Posted 9 days ago
Photo of the Rise User
Posted 6 days ago
Photo of the Rise User
Electra Hybrid Boulder, Colorado, United States
Posted 9 days ago
Photo of the Rise User
Posted 4 days ago
Photo of the Rise User
Posted 4 days ago
Photo of the Rise User
Bekum Group Hybrid 1140 W Grand River Ave, Williamston, MI 48895, USA
Posted 14 days ago
MATCH
Calculating your matching score...
FUNDING
DEPARTMENTS
SENIORITY LEVEL REQUIREMENT
TEAM SIZE
EMPLOYMENT TYPE
Full-time, remote
DATE POSTED
January 11, 2025

Subscribe to Rise newsletter

Risa star 🔮 Hi, I'm Risa! Your AI
Career Copilot
Want to see a list of jobs tailored to
you, just ask me below!